Amy Bowman

Amy Bowman

LCSW

Amy is a Licensed Clinical Social Worker with over 20 years of experience working with individuals, couples, and families. She provides care in both in-person and telehealth settings, utilizing a collaborative and personalized approach.

Amy uses a client-centered and strengths-based approach, integrating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Mindfulness-Based Therapy, and Motivational Interviewing to support healing and well-being. She is trained in PTSD therapies through Star Behavioral Health with a focus on military-specific trauma, and has experience working with military personnel and first responders.
